July 5, 2026 – We left Friday Harbor and sailed north to the Wasp Islands. There was a report of orcas, the T100’s (minus T100B’s and T100E), circling Flattop Island so we kept our speed up to head for Spring Pass to Flattop Island. We met the orcas as they came around the south side of Flattop and sailed alongside towards Pt Disney. We left the orcas to return to Flattop to explore the coastline where many harbor seals with new pups were hauled out and an adult bald eagle was near its chick the nest. On hearing the orcas had changed course for White Rock we did the same. Some nice views as they circled White Rock where many harbor seals were hauled out and bald eagles were engaged in eating something on top of the island. The orcas who had been northbound from White Rock then changed course to the south towards Flattop Island. We split off to cut through Ripple Island, and the Cactus Islands and to check out the north side of Spieden Island in New Channel. A good sail south down San Juan Channel where we caught up with the T100’s again as they traveled towards Friday Harbor.
